導(dǎo)出與導(dǎo)入Docker的容器實(shí)現(xiàn)示例
本文主要講解Docker容器的導(dǎo)入與導(dǎo)出,可以用作容器快照的備份。
Docker容器的導(dǎo)出
1.首先使用命令查看已經(jīng)創(chuàng)建的Docker容器
docker ps -a
這個(gè)時(shí)候可以看到container id
也就是容器ID,我們只要根據(jù)容器ID就能導(dǎo)出相應(yīng)的容器
2.導(dǎo)出某個(gè)容器
導(dǎo)出某個(gè)容器,非常簡單,使用docker export
命令,語法:docker export $container_id > 容器快照名
3.查看導(dǎo)出的容器
ls
4.下載容器
查看當(dāng)前所在路徑
pwd
知道容器路徑在tmp下,我們可以直接使用FTP遠(yuǎn)程工具連接到主機(jī)進(jìn)行下載:
等待容器文件下載即可
Docker容器的導(dǎo)入
導(dǎo)入某個(gè)容器–docker import命令
有了容器快照之后,我們可以在想要的時(shí)候隨時(shí)導(dǎo)入。導(dǎo)入快照使用docker import命令。
1.首先來到容器文件所在目錄下
上面我們說到容器導(dǎo)出的目錄在tmp下,那我們就直接來到tmp目錄
cd /tmp
2.導(dǎo)入容器
docker import halo.tar halo:latest
OPTIONS說明:
-halo.tar : 選擇要導(dǎo)入的容器文件名
-halo:latest : 指定容器名稱和版本
導(dǎo)入和導(dǎo)出的過程大同小異這里不再圖片演示
3.完事之后可以刪除容器文件
rm -rf /tmp/halo.tar
到此這篇關(guān)于導(dǎo)出與導(dǎo)入Docker的容器實(shí)現(xiàn)示例的文章就介紹到這了,更多相關(guān)導(dǎo)出與導(dǎo)入Docker的容器內(nèi)容請搜索本站以前的文章或繼續(xù)瀏覽下面的相關(guān)文章希望大家以后多多支持本站!
版權(quán)聲明:本站文章來源標(biāo)注為YINGSOO的內(nèi)容版權(quán)均為本站所有,歡迎引用、轉(zhuǎn)載,請保持原文完整并注明來源及原文鏈接。禁止復(fù)制或仿造本網(wǎng)站,禁止在非www.sddonglingsh.com所屬的服務(wù)器上建立鏡像,否則將依法追究法律責(zé)任。本站部分內(nèi)容來源于網(wǎng)友推薦、互聯(lián)網(wǎng)收集整理而來,僅供學(xué)習(xí)參考,不代表本站立場,如有內(nèi)容涉嫌侵權(quán),請聯(lián)系alex-e#qq.com處理。